Jardins de Chevrise is located in the Mount Vernon section of the French side of the island.
It is a great value for the price. The hotel is clean and well-maintained. The staff is friendly and helpful. Our philosophy is that we only sleep and shower in our room. As long as it is quiet and clean, we are satisfied. We were very satisfied.
The rooms are studios with small kitchens. The floors are tile, décor spare, but functional. A nice touch was the fresh cut flowers left by the staff. Each room has an air-conditioner operated by a remote control. The water pressure was a bit weak, but since St. Martin has to produce all their water through a desalinization plant, maybe it is a conservation measure. Anyhow, there is water enough to take a shower and get clean.
Also, there is a small color TV that gets only HBO on its one channel. The beds are made up for you each day. We felt the mattress was a bit hard, but not uncomfortably so. Fresh towels are set up each day, too. The hotel will rent you beach towels if you ask.
If you are interested in cooking, you can rent the dishes, etc. Breakfast is by the pool, which is located in a lovely plant-filled courtyard. It is extra, seven euros per person, per day; a little steep, but very nice and convenient.
There is a bakery nearby, within walking distance if you’d like to get your own rolls or croissants. The hotel breakfast is a nice way to meet some of your fellow guests. There were lots of Europeans at the hotel when we were here – mostly French, a Canadian group that was departing just after we had arrived, and a nice German couple that we practiced our high school German on.
St. Martin is a delight, and Jardins de Chevrise the perfect quiet spot for your headquarters as you explore the island. |

We stayed at the Jardins de Chevrise. It was a bare basic accomodation.
We're low maintainence people, but I would have expected the sheets to be changed each day and the shower cleaned. Not so.
The walk to Orient Beach was more like 15 minutes down the path behind the resorts. Then, to get to the "chaired" area of Orient Beach, it's another 10-15 minute walk along the beach.
The resort is 220 wiring, not noted in the brochure or web site - which means a converter if you're from the US. There were only six TV stations (six of the same station from Guadeloupe and TNT w/o audio).
The staff was nice, the breakfast was simple - and available for $12 daily. |
